HISTORIC FLAG-HOISTING CEREMONY HELD AT KHUNJERAB ON 77TH INDEPENDENCE DAY

INDEPENDENT DESK
Gilgit: August 14,

A historic flag-hoisting ceremony was held at Khunjerab, the highest point on the Pak-China border, to mark the 77th Independence Day of Pakistan. Chief Minister Gilgit-Baltistan Haji Gulbar Khan and Force Commander Major General Kashif Khilji (Sitara-e-Jurat) hoisted the flag at the highest point in Pakistan.

The ceremony was attended by former Governor Mir Ghazanfar Ali Khan, Speaker Gilgit-Baltistan Assembly Nazir Ahmed Advocate, Provincial Minister for Social Welfare and Women’s Rights Dilshad Bano, Assembly Members Amjad Advocate, Colonel (R) Ubaidullah Beg, and other dignitaries.

School children presented national songs, and a smartly turned-out contingent of Pakistan Army presented a salute. Chief Minister Gilgit-Baltistan Haji Gulbar Khan addressed the ceremony, highlighting the significance of the day and the importance of the region.

The event was witnessed by a large number of domestic and foreign tourists, and was a testament to the country’s commitment to its sovereignty and territorial integrity.
